Scholarships

When it comes to financing education, school fees can be a burden for many families.

However, there are community support options available in Nigeria to help alleviate the financial strain. One such option is scholarships.

The various scholarships available for students in Nigeria

Scholarships provide students with a way to fund their education without the worry of exorbitant fees.

In Nigeria, there are various scholarships available for students, catering to different needs and circumstances.

Academic scholarships are the most common type and are based on merit.

These scholarships are awarded to students who have demonstrated exceptional academic performance and show promise in their chosen fields of study.

Academic scholarships not only cover tuition fees but may also provide additional financial support for educational expenses.

Need-based scholarships are designed to assist financially disadvantaged students who may not have the means to pay for their education.

These scholarships take into consideration the student’s financial situation and provide support based on their needs.

Need-based scholarships can cover all or part of the school fees, depending on the circumstances.

In addition, there are scholarships provided by private organizations or foundations.

These scholarships are often targeted towards specific groups such as minority students, students from underrepresented communities, or students pursuing specific fields of study.

These scholarships typically have specific eligibility criteria and requirements.

The application process and requirements for scholarships

The application process for scholarships usually involves filling out an application form, providing relevant documents such as academic transcripts, recommendation letters, and a personal statement.

It is crucial to carefully follow the instructions and submit all necessary documents within the given deadline.

Tips for increasing the chances of securing a scholarship

Apart from fulfilling the application requirements, there are some tips that can help students increase their chances of securing a scholarship.

Firstly, students should start their scholarship search early.

Many scholarships have early deadlines, so it is important to begin the process well in advance.

Students should research and compile a list of scholarships they are eligible for and keep track of the deadlines.

Secondly, students should tailor their applications to each scholarship.

They should take the time to understand the specific requirements of each scholarship and showcase how they meet those requirements.

Personalizing the application can make a difference in standing out from other applicants.

Furthermore, students should seek assistance from their school counselors or mentors.

These individuals can provide guidance and help students identify suitable scholarships.

They can also review applications and provide valuable feedback.

Lastly, students should take the opportunity to showcase their extracurricular activities, leadership skills, and community involvement.

Many scholarships value well-rounded individuals who contribute to their communities.

Highlighting these aspects in the application can strengthen the chances of securing a scholarship.

Government Programs

Government-sponsored programs aimed at supporting education

  1. The Universal Basic Education Commission (UBEC) programs provide financial aid for school fees.

  2. State governments offer scholarships and education assistance initiatives for students in need.

The eligibility criteria and application process for government programs

To be eligible for UBEC programs, students must come from low-income families and attend public schools.

The application process involves filling out forms provided by school authorities and submitting necessary documents.

For state governments’ scholarships and education assistance initiatives, eligibility criteria may vary depending on the specific program.

Generally, students must demonstrate financial need, academic merit, or exceptional talents.

They must submit applications through designated channels and provide relevant documents to support their claims.

The benefits and limitations of relying on government support

Relying on government support for school fees has several benefits. It ensures that education is accessible to all, regardless of financial background.

Government programs alleviate the burden of school fees for low-income families, reducing the chances of children dropping out of school due to financial constraints.

Moreover, government-sponsored programs usually have transparent and standardized processes, making it easier for students to apply and receive assistance.

This reduces the chances of discrimination or favoritism.

However, there are also limitations to relying solely on government support for school fees.

Government funds might not be sufficient to cover all educational expenses, including books, uniforms, and extracurricular activities.

This can still pose a financial burden on families, especially those living below the poverty line.

Government programs might also face challenges in implementing and sustaining support.

Bureaucracy, corruption, and mismanagement can hinder the effective distribution of funds, impacting the timely disbursement of financial aid to students in need.

Furthermore, government support might not be available to all students, as eligibility criteria can limit access.

Students who do not meet the specific requirements might be excluded from receiving assistance, leaving them with limited options for financing their education.

Community-based Fundraising

The concept of community-based fundraising for school fees

Fundraising events are a fantastic way to promote community involvement and support.

They not only provide financial assistance but also bring people together, fostering a stronger sense of unity and shared responsibility.

The different methods for raising funds within a community

Talent shows and car washes are two popular options for fundraising events.

Talent shows allow community members to showcase their skills while raising money.

From singers and dancers to magicians and comedians, the talent show can be an enjoyable experience for everyone involved.

Participants can sell tickets, and local businesses can sponsor the event, creating a win-win situation for all.

Car washes are another great way to raise funds.

Students, teachers, and even parents can come together and offer car cleaning services to the community for a nominal fee.

This not only helps to raise money but also provides an opportunity to interact with community members and share information about the school and its needs.

In addition to traditional fundraising events, community-driven crowdfunding campaigns have gained popularity in recent years.

Platforms such as GoFundMe or Kickstarter enable individuals to easily contribute online.

Engaging the community through social media, personalized emails, and word-of-mouth can significantly increase the success of these campaigns.

To encourage active community participation, it is crucial to create a sense of shared responsibility.

Clearly communicate how the funds will be used and how it will directly benefit the students.

People are more likely to contribute when they know their support will make a significant impact.

Engaging stakeholders early in the planning process helps cultivate a sense of ownership and commitment.

Actively involve teachers, parents, and community leaders in decision-making and organizing events.

By giving them a platform to voice their opinions and contribute ideas, you can build a stronger bond between the school and the community.

Maximizing community engagement requires leveraging various communication channels.

Social media platforms, newsletters, local newspapers, and community bulletin boards are all effective ways to spread the word about fundraising efforts.

Regularly update the community on progress, share success stories, and express gratitude to keep them informed and motivated.

Offering incentives or rewards can also boost community participation.

Local businesses could provide discounts or special offers to those who contribute a certain amount.

This not only encourages people to donate but also supports local businesses and strengthens community ties.

Local Support Networks

In the pursuit of academic excellence, families often find themselves grappling with the financial burden of school fees.

However, amidst the challenges, a ray of hope emerges in the form of local support networks.

These networks, consisting of extended family members, neighbors, and friends, play a pivotal role in creating a community-driven approach to overcome the hurdles of educational expenses.

Local Support Networks: Building Foundations for Success

Importance of Developing Local Support Networks

Creating local support networks for school fees is more than just a financial strategy; it’s a community investment in the future.

These networks foster a sense of belonging and shared responsibility, reinforcing the idea that education is a collective endeavor.

As the African proverb says, “It takes a village to raise a child,” and the same principle applies to supporting educational aspirations.

Role of Extended Family Members, Neighbors, and Friends

Extended family members, neighbors, and friends form the backbone of these local support networks.

Grandparents, aunts, uncles, and even family friends can contribute not only financially but also through emotional support and mentorship.

Neighbors, who share a common interest in the community’s well-being, can collaborate to create a support system that ensures no child is left behind due to financial constraints.

Tips on Building Strong Support Networks

  1. Open Communication: Foster transparent communication within the community. Encourage families to openly discuss their financial challenges and educational aspirations, creating an environment where support can be offered without judgment.

  2. Community Events: Organize community events and workshops to bring people together. These gatherings provide opportunities to discuss challenges, share experiences, and brainstorm innovative solutions to support one another.

  3. Skill-sharing Initiatives: Encourage the exchange of skills and resources within the community. Perhaps someone is proficient in tutoring certain subjects, while another excels in financial planning. By leveraging these talents, the community can collectively contribute to the educational journey of its members.
